千锋教育-做有情怀、有良心、有品质的职业教育机构

手机站
千锋教育

千锋学习站 | 随时随地免费学

千锋教育

扫一扫进入千锋手机站

领取全套视频
千锋教育

关注千锋学习站小程序
随时随地免费学习课程

当前位置:首页  >  行业资讯  > 零基础学java系列教程

零基础学java系列教程

来源:千锋教育
发布人:xqq
时间: 2024-08-18 09:00:34 1723942834

### 零基础学Java系列教程:开启你的编程之旅

_x000D_

在当今数字化时代,编程已成为一项不可或缺的技能。无论你是想进入IT行业,还是希望提升自己的职业竞争力,学习一门编程语言都是明智的选择。而Java作为一种广泛使用的编程语言,凭借其跨平台性和强大的功能,成为了众多开发者的首选。如果你是零基础的初学者,不用担心,千锋教育为你提供了系统、全面的Java学习教程,帮助你从零开始,逐步掌握这门语言。

_x000D_

千锋教育的Java课程设计合理,内容丰富,从基础语法到高级编程技巧,涵盖了Java的各个方面。无论你是学生、在职人员,还是对编程感兴趣的爱好者,千锋教育都能为你量身定制学习计划,助你快速上手。接下来,我们将为你详细介绍零基础学Java的几个关键方面,帮助你更好地理解和掌握这门语言。

_x000D_

一、Java语言的基础知识

_x000D_

Java是一种面向对象的编程语言,具有平台无关性、强类型、安全性等特点。在学习Java之前,首先要了解其基本概念和术语。Java的基本组成包括类、对象、方法和变量等。类是Java程序的基本构建块,定义了对象的属性和行为;对象是类的实例,通过对象可以访问类中的方法和变量。

_x000D_

在Java中,数据类型分为基本数据类型和引用数据类型。基本数据类型包括整型、浮点型、字符型和布尔型等,而引用数据类型则包括类、接口和数组等。掌握这些基础知识对于后续学习Java至关重要。

_x000D_

Java的语法规则也相对简单易懂。它采用了类似于C++的语法结构,代码块以大括号{}来标识,语句以分号;结束。了解这些基本语法规则后,初学者可以尝试编写简单的Java程序,从而加深对语言的理解。

_x000D_

二、Java开发环境的搭建

_x000D_

在学习Java之前,首先需要搭建一个合适的开发环境。千锋教育提供了详细的环境搭建教程,帮助学员快速完成这一过程。通常,我们需要安装Java Development Kit(JDK)和集成开发环境(IDE)如Eclipse或IntelliJ IDEA。

_x000D_

下载并安装JDK。JDK是Java开发的核心工具包,包含了编译器和Java运行环境。安装完成后,需要配置环境变量,以便在命令行中使用Java命令。

_x000D_

接下来,选择一个适合自己的IDE。Eclipse和IntelliJ IDEA是目前最流行的Java开发工具。Eclipse界面友好,功能强大,适合初学者;而IntelliJ IDEA则提供了更为智能的代码提示和自动补全功能,适合有一定基础的开发者。安装IDE后,可以创建一个新的Java项目,开始你的编程之旅。

_x000D_

三、Java核心语法与编程思想

_x000D_

掌握Java的核心语法是学习编程的关键。Java的基本语法包括变量声明、数据类型、控制结构(如if语句、循环语句)等。通过学习这些语法,初学者可以编写出简单的程序,理解程序的逻辑结构。

_x000D_

在Java中,面向对象编程(OOP)是一个重要的编程思想。OOP强调通过对象来组织代码,使程序更具可读性和可维护性。Java中的四大特性:封装、继承、多态和抽象,都是OOP的重要组成部分。初学者需要理解这些概念,并在实际编程中加以应用。

_x000D_

异常处理也是Java编程中不可忽视的部分。Java提供了try-catch语句来捕获和处理异常,确保程序的稳定性。掌握异常处理机制,可以帮助初学者更好地调试和优化代码。

_x000D_

四、Java常用类库与框架

_x000D_

Java拥有丰富的类库和框架,这些工具可以大大提高开发效率。常用的Java类库包括Java Collections Framework、Java I/O、Java Networking等。通过学习这些类库,初学者可以快速实现常见的功能,如数据存储、文件操作和网络通信等。

_x000D_

在现代开发中,框架的使用也变得越来越普遍。Spring、Hibernate和Struts等框架可以帮助开发者更高效地构建企业级应用。千锋教育的课程中,涵盖了这些常用框架的使用方法,帮助学员在实际项目中应用所学知识。

_x000D_

学习Java的过程中,了解常用类库和框架,不仅能提高编程效率,还能增强对Java生态系统的理解。这对初学者未来的职业发展大有裨益。

_x000D_

五、项目实战与经验积累

_x000D_

学习编程最有效的方式之一就是通过实践。千锋教育提供了丰富的项目实战课程,让学员在真实的开发环境中锻炼自己的编程能力。通过参与项目,初学者可以将理论知识应用到实践中,加深对Java的理解。

_x000D_

在项目实战中,学员将面临各种开发挑战,如需求分析、系统设计、代码实现和测试等。这些经历不仅能提升学员的技术能力,还能培养团队合作和项目管理的能力。

_x000D_

积累项目经验也是求职时的重要资产。拥有实际项目经验的求职者往往更受雇主青睐。通过千锋教育的项目实战课程,学员能够在简历中添加丰富的项目经历,为未来的职业发展铺平道路。

_x000D_

六、学习资源与社区支持

_x000D_

在学习Java的过程中,良好的学习资源和社区支持是不可或缺的。千锋教育为学员提供了丰富的学习资料,包括视频教程、电子书和在线文档等。学员还可以通过千锋教育的在线论坛,与其他学习者进行交流,分享学习经验和解决问题。

_x000D_

网络上也有许多免费的学习资源,如Java官方文档、编程学习网站和开源项目等。初学者可以通过这些资源,扩展自己的知识面,提升编程能力。

_x000D_

加入编程社区也是一个不错的选择。在社区中,初学者可以结识志同道合的朋友,互相学习和帮助。这种学习氛围能够激励学员不断进步,提升编程水平。

_x000D_

###

_x000D_

学习Java是一段充满挑战与乐趣的旅程。千锋教育为零基础学员提供了系统、全面的学习资源和支持,帮助你从零开始,逐步掌握这门语言。无论你未来的职业规划如何,掌握编程技能都将为你打开更多的机会和可能性。现在就加入千锋教育,开启你的Java学习之旅吧!

_x000D_
tags: IT培训
声明:本站稿件版权均属千锋教育所有,未经许可不得擅自转载。
10年以上业内强师集结,手把手带你蜕变精英
请您保持通讯畅通,专属学习老师24小时内将与您1V1沟通
免费领取
今日已有369人领取成功
刘同学 138****2860 刚刚成功领取
王同学 131****2015 刚刚成功领取
张同学 133****4652 刚刚成功领取
李同学 135****8607 刚刚成功领取
杨同学 132****5667 刚刚成功领取
岳同学 134****6652 刚刚成功领取
梁同学 157****2950 刚刚成功领取
刘同学 189****1015 刚刚成功领取
张同学 155****4678 刚刚成功领取
邹同学 139****2907 刚刚成功领取
董同学 138****2867 刚刚成功领取
周同学 136****3602 刚刚成功领取
相关推荐HOT